Taming the Fluffy Fury: Managing Cat Shedding with Ease
Tired of fuzz clinging to every surface? Living with a cat can be pure joy, but their shedding can sometimes feel like an endless battle. Don't fret! With a few simple tips and tricks, you can minimize that feline fluff and keep your home spick-and-span.
Here are some helpful strategies to combat cat shedding:
- Regular brushing is key! Invest in a good quality brush designed for cats and brush them daily. This will remove loose fur before it lands on your furniture.
- Feed your cat a high-quality diet rich in nutrients to promote healthy skin and coat. A shiny, healthy coat sheds less!
- Create a clean and cozy environment for your cat. Stress can contribute to excessive shedding, so make sure they have plenty of places to relax and play.
- Use furniture covers or throws to protect your sofa from stray fur. These can be easily washed and replaced when necessary.
- Sweep regularly, paying special attention to areas where your cat spends a lot of time. Invest in a vacuum with a HEPA filter to trap even the smallest particles of fur.
By following these tips, you can successfully manage your cat's shedding and keep your home a happy and fur-free haven.
